Electronic Sound Workshops

These school holidays, kids will have the opportunity to try their hand at electronic music production with a series of fun and inspiring workshops facilitated by Hack Sounds in partnership with 107 Projects and Carlin McClellan from Play Anything. Enjoy making beats, melodies and compositions from scratch.

Suitable for ages 8-12.

Where: Hyde Park Barracks
When: Saturday 9 July: 10am, 12pm & 2pm and Sunday 10 July: 10am, 12pm & 2pm 
Cost: General: $15, Member: $12. Each participant ticket includes one free parent/carer.

Walking through a Songline

Follow in the steps of the Seven Sisters and immerse yourself in a songline through this multi-sensory digital installation. Experience a space of light and sound where paintings come to life, stories are visualised, and ancient knowledge is shared in new ways. Afterwards, take part in a craft activity in the viewing cube space and make a family tree as part of the Walking through a Songline exhibition.

Where:   Museum of Sydney, Corner Phillip and Bridge Streets, Sydney
When:    Until 17 July 2022
Cost:      Free entry (weekends until 30 June then every day from 1 July)

Hyde Park Barracks Kids’ Trail

Come on an adventure through time at the Hyde Park Barracks with a tailored audio guide and activity trail for kids. Hear the fascinating story of the Barracks as told by some of the convicts and immigrants who lived there, plus listen for clues and complete some fun activities as you move through the museum – spot the rats, draw your own convict tattoo and more! Suitable for kids 5-12 years.

Where:  Hyde Park Barracks, Queens Square, Sydney
When:   Open Thursday to Sunday, 10am – 5pm
Cost:     Free weekend entry until 30 June. Half price entry from 1 July.
